BYD has introduced the world's first*¹ accident compensation system for urban NOA (Navigate on Autopilot), covering economic losses incurred while complying with laws and regulations.

The company also announced China's first*² self-developed 4nm automotive AI chip, 'Xuanji A3', achieving both high performance and low power consumption, and has entered mass production.

With the vision of 'Intelligent Driving for All', BYD aims to achieve zero traffic accidents through the deployment of LiDAR across all models and continuous R&D investment.

– Shenzhen, China, May 28, 2026

At its Intelligent Strategy Conference held on May 28, BYD announced the introduction of a compensation system for the 'Urban NOA' function of its 'God's Eye Driver Assistance System' for the Chinese market. The company also unveiled China's first*² self-developed 4nm automotive smart driving SoC (System on Chip), 'Xuanji A3'.

With this announcement, BYD becomes the world's first*¹ automaker to offer a compensation system for urban NOA functions, in addition to its intelligent parking feature. Under its 'Intelligent Driving for All' strategy, BYD also announced that a LiDAR-equipped version of the 'God's Eye' driver assistance system will be available across its entire lineup.

*1, *2 As of May 28, 2026, according to BYD's own research.

■ BYD's Vision for the Smart Driving Era

BYD has set the following three goals for the smart driving era:

- Achieving 'Zero Traffic Accidents'
- Realizing 'Super Driver' through driver assistance systems
- Realizing 'Super Personal Assistant' through AI

To achieve these goals, BYD will continue to invest over 100 billion RMB (approximately 2 trillion yen) in cumulative R&D in the smart driving field, aiming to provide a safer mobility experience for all users.

■ Introduction of Compensation System for Urban NOA

The compensation system announced this time will be provided to users in the Chinese market who have equipped or upgraded to the 'God's Eye Driver Assistance System 5.0'. If an accident occurs while the target user is using the urban NOA function in compliance with laws and system usage conditions, and the user is found legally responsible, BYD will compensate for the economic losses incurred.

BYD's ability to implement such initiatives is backed by the largest fleet of smart driving-capable vehicles among Chinese automakers, with over 3.15 million units in operation, over 200 million km of driving data per day, and continuous technological development by a 5,000-person R&D team.

■ Further Evolution of the 'God's Eye Driver Assistance System'

BYD announced the following four updates to the 'God's Eye Driver Assistance System':

- Xuanji Architecture 2.0
- Industry-first satellite sensor architecture
- Evolved physical AI large model
- Data flywheel utilizing large-scale real-world driving scenarios

Additionally, the in-vehicle infotainment system 'DiLink AI Smart Cockpit' will be equipped with an AI agent function. By understanding user intentions and performing proactive suggestions and tasks, it will provide a more advanced in-car experience.

■ China's First Self-Developed 4nm Automotive Smart Driving SoC 'Xuanji A3'

At the conference, BYD also unveiled China's first self-developed 4nm automotive smart driving SoC, 'Xuanji A3'. The chip is developed with a view to supporting L3 and L4 level autonomous driving, achieving over 2,100 TOPS*³ of computing performance in a three-chip configuration.

*3 Tera Operations per Second, a unit representing how many trillion operations can be executed per second. 100 TOPS means 100 trillion operations per second.

Furthermore, while adopting an advanced 4nm process, it reduces power consumption per TOPS by approximately 20% compared to同类 products. It has already entered mass production and, combined with BYD's proprietary algorithms, supports further improvements in safety and performance.

■ From Blade Battery to Smart Driving

BYD has been working to improve the safety of electric vehicles through its Blade Battery. In the smart driving era, the company continues to position 'safety' and 'trust' as its most important values.

Through technological innovation with the 'God's Eye Driver Assistance System', the self-developed 'Xuanji A3' chip, and the introduction of a compensation system to ensure peace of mind, BYD aims to realize a safer and more secure mobility society.
